Detailed Description

\qmltype AudioInput \nativetype QAudioInput

An audio input to be used for capturing audio in a capture session.

\inqmlmodule QtMultimedia

\qml CaptureSession { id: playMusic audioInput: AudioInput { volume: slider.value } recorder: MediaRecorder { ... } } Slider { id: slider from: 0. to: 1. } \endqml

You can use AudioInput together with a QtMultiMedia::CaptureSession to capture audio from an audio input device.

See also
Camera, AudioOutput

Represents an input channel for audio. \inmodule QtMultimedia

This class represents an input channel that can be used together with QMediaCaptureSession. It enables the selection of the physical input device to be used, muting the channel, and changing the channel's volume.

Note
On WebAssembly platform, due to its asynchronous nature, QMediaDevices::audioInputsChanged() signal is emitted when the list of audio inputs is ready. User permissions are required. Works only on secure https contexts.

Property Documentation

◆ device

QAudioDevice QAudioInput::device
readwrite

\qmlproperty AudioDevice QtMultimedia::AudioInput::device

This property describes the audio device connected to this input.

The device property represents the audio device this input is connected to. This property can be used to select an output device from the QtMultimedia::MediaDevices::audioInputs() list.

The audio device connected to this input.

The device property represents the audio device connected to this input. This property can be used to select an input device from the QMediaDevices::audioInputs() list.

You can select the system default audio input by setting this property to a default constructed QAudioDevice object.

◆ volume

float QAudioInput::volume
readwrite

\qmlproperty real QtMultimedia::AudioInput::volume

The volume is scaled linearly, ranging from 0 (silence) to 1 (full volume).

Note
values outside this range will be clamped.

By default the volume is 1.

UI volume controls should usually be scaled non-linearly. For example, using a logarithmic scale will produce linear changes in perceived loudness, which is what a user would normally expect from a volume control.
